The Stollen snowshoe trail leads from the Klewenalp mountain station past the Klewen chapel, through the idyllic forest landscape up to the Stollen viewing point and back down to Klewenalp.

Experience the fascination of snowshoeing in the beautiful winter wonderland on Klewenalp, high above Lake Lucerne.

This varied snowshoe hike takes you from the Klewenalp mountain station past the Klewen chapel. After a short crossing of the Ergglen ski slope, you reach the idyllic forest landscape. Many forest clearings offer bre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ains of Central Switzerland and the deep blue waters of Lake Lucerne.

The covered year-round Ergglen fireplace or the PanoramaBar, Klewenstock, Alpstubli and KlewenStube 1600 mountain restaurants invite you to take a leisurely break on the way back to the Klewenalp mountain station (opening times at www.klewenalp.ch).

Directions & Parking facilities

Take the highway A2 Luzern-Gotthard, exit Buochs/Beckenried and follow the signs to the valley station of the cable car Beckenried-Klewenalp
Paid parking spaces are available in Beckenried at the valley station of the Beckenried-Klewenalp cable car. 
By post bus: from Stans, railroad station to Beckenried, post office
By boat: from Lucerne or Brunnen to Beckenried

Safety guidelines

General safety instructions:

  • The snowshoe trail is marked along the entire route
  • The Stollen viewpoint, which is accessible in summer, is not part of the route due to the steep, sloping terrain. Hike at your own risk!
  • Inform yourself early and independently about the current snow and avalanche conditions

Rules of conduct:

  • Allow enough time, rest regularly.
  • Do not take any unnecessary risks and always monitor the weather
  • Always stay on the marked route, avoid shortcuts
  • Avoid forest edges, afforestation and small young growth
  • Avoid game wherever possible
  • Observe animals from an appropriate distance
  • If possible, leave dogs at home or keep them on a lead
  • Only take reminders with you and only leave your tracks!
